Typical Causes of Glass Damage

Comprehending what triggers glass damage can help in lessening the risk of damage. Here are a few of the most typical causes:

  1. Accidental Impact: Objects clashing with glass are a main source of damage, frequently resulting in fractures or chips.
  2. Temperature Changes: Rapid temperature level fluctuations can cause thermal stress in glass, leading to breakage.
  3. Production Defects: Sometimes, a defect in the glass might exist from the outset, making it more prone to damage.
  4. Ecological Factors: Environmental issues such as hail, strong winds, or falling debris can trigger significant damage to glass structures.
  5. Poor Installation: Inadequately installed glass can result in improper stress distribution, leading to fractures gradually.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Can all kinds of glass be repaired?

Not all glass types can be fixed. Tempered glass or deeply shattered panes normally require total replacement.

2. For how long does the glass repair procedure take?

Small repairs can be completed in less than an hour, while full pane replacement might take numerous hours to a number of days, depending on the intricacy.

3. Is it safe to drive with a cracked windscreen?

It's not a good idea. A broken windshield can impair your vision and be a safety hazard. Repairs need to be done as quickly as possible.

4. How can I avoid additional damage to repaired glass?

Avoid any tension on the repaired area and if it is a windshield, do not clean the cars and truck for a few days post-repair to ensure the resin sets effectively.

5. Is glass repair covered by property owners or automobile insurance coverage?

Numerous insurance policies cover glass repair expenditures. It's necessary to consult your insurance coverage company for specifics.
